This May, Christie's 20/21 Century sales in New York brings together works from the greatest artists of Impressionist and Modern Art and Post-War and Contemporary Art. A Century of Art: The Gerald Fineberg Collection presents a rich and nuanced collection of 20th-century masterpieces in a standalone two-part auction. Historic collections also return this season as Visionary: The Collection of Paul G. Allen takes an in-depth look at art rooted in nature while Masterpieces from the S.I. Newhouse Collection offers 16 groundbreaking works from the media magnate’s 20th-century trove. Depth of Field: The Alan & Dorothy Press Collection and Enduring Threads: The Collection of Jacques and Emy Cohenca round out an exceptional sale series.
